private static void goPost(String host, int port, String contextPath,
String dir) throws Exception
{
// First compose the post request data
ByteArrayOutputStream ba = new ByteArrayOutputStream();
ba.write("--AaB03x\r\n".getBytes());
// Write header for the first file
ba.write("Content-Disposition: form-data; name=\"myFile\"; filename=\"test.txt\"\r\n".getBytes());
ba.write("Content-Type: text/plain\r\n\r\n".getBytes());
// Write content of first text file
byte[] file1Bytes = Files.readAllBytes(Paths.get(dir, "test.txt"));
ba.write(file1Bytes, 0, file1Bytes.length);
ba.write("\r\n--AaB03x\r\n".getBytes());
// Write header for the second file
ba.write("Content-Disposition: form-data; name=\"myFile2\"; filename=\"test2.txt\"\r\n".getBytes());
ba.write("Content-Type: text/plain\r\n\r\n".getBytes());
// Write content of second text file
byte[] file2Bytes = Files.readAllBytes(Paths.get(dir, "test2.txt"));
ba.write(file2Bytes, 0, file2Bytes.length);
ba.write("\r\n--AaB03x\r\n".getBytes());
// Write header for the third part, this is has no file name
ba.write("Content-Disposition: form-data; name=\"xyz\"\r\n".getBytes());
ba.write("Content-Type: text/plain\r\n\r\n".getBytes());
ba.write("1234567abcdefg".getBytes());
// Write boundary end
ba.write("\r\n--AaB03x--\r\n".getBytes());
byte[] data = ba.toByteArray();
// Compose the post request header
StringBuilder header = new StringBuilder();
header.append("POST " + contextPath + " HTTP/1.1\r\n");
header.append("Host: localhost\r\n");
header.append("Connection: close\r\n");
header.append("Content-Type: multipart/form-data; boundary=AaB03x\r\n");
header.append("Content-Length: " + data.length + "\r\n\r\n");
